5 bold predictions for the Chiefs against the Ravens
Travis Kelce wonāt catch a touchdown pass
Travis Kelce has played the Ravens four times. Heās been effective against them, averaging 6.5 receptions and 81.5 yards per meeting. However, heās grabbed a touchdown just once in those games.
Coming off a two-touchdown outing against the Browns, Kelce wonāt touch the endzone in this one, ending his streak of touchdowns in five consecutive regular-season NFL games.
The good news for the Chiefs is they donāt need Kelce to catch touchdowns when theyāve got Tyreek Hill and a host of other weapons for Mahomes to find throughout the game.
And itās not like Kelce wonāt help them get to the end zone. Heāll be a critically valuable part of the offense as usual. He just wonāt add to his touchdown total this week.
